The US and South Korea are conducting another joint exercise in the wake of the North Korean sinking of the Cheonan. The North Koreans are pooping off at the mouth as usual but they have sense enough to know how far to go.

This exercise is an annual exercise called Ulchi Freedom Guardian. It is a computerized exercise so it doesn’t require units to go to the field en masse.
